5.   Test Circuit Operation.
a.   Connect temporary jumper leads across 
relay contacts, primary interlock and door 
sensing switches to simulate shorted switch 
contacts. Locate convenient connections in 
circuit to be certain COM and NO terminals 
are used.
b.  Connect ohmmeter (Rx1) across the line 
terminals of the appliance cord. Continuity 
must show the following:
 
• Door Closed : Some Ω
 
• Door Open :  .3 Ω
c.   Remove 20 amp fuse. Circuit must open 
(infi nity
 
Ω). If not, check wiring of monitor 
and interlock circuits.
WARNING: After test, remove temporary jumper 
leads from interlock and relay.
WARNING: Primary interlock, door sensing switch, 
monitor switch, and relay board must be replaced 
when the 20 amp fuse is blown due to operation of 
monitor switch.
Note: Perform microwave leakage test when 
replacing or adjusting interlock switches or latch 
board.
How to Adjust the Interlocks:
The latch board is adjustable for proper door closure 
and switch operation.
Disconnect power and partially remove the 
oven from it’s installation. (See 
Oven Removal / 
Partial Removal.
)
Note:  Each latch board is held in place and adjusted 
with 2 Phillips-head screws. The screws are recessed 
from the top of the outer cover. Access holes are 
provided.
2.   Loosen the 2 Phillips-head screws that attach 
the latch board to the oven chassis.
3.   Adjust each latch-board for proper door closure 
and switch operation, retighten screws.
Note: Perform microwave leakage test when 
replacing or adjusting interlock switches or latch 
boards.

To replace the door switches:
Place the oven in a partially removed position. 
(See 
Oven Removal / Partial Removal
.)
Open the oven door.
Remove the single Phillips-head screw that 
holds the door switch access cover to the outer 
cover.
Disconnect the switch wiring.
Using a fl at blade screwdriver, carefully press 
the  lock tab until fl ush with the surrounding 
area of the latch board.
Using the mounting pin as a pivot, carefully 
rotate the switch past the lock tab and  
Remove the switch from the mounting pin.
